Molasses Sugar Cookies II

These taste like a ginger cookie. They can be either crispy or chewy, depending on when they are taken out of the oven. Balls of dough are formed, then rolled in sugar and baked.

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Melt shortening and cool. Add sugar, eggs and molasses; beat well.
Step 2
Sift the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, salt, ground cloves and ginger. Add to the molasses mixture and stir until well combined. Chill dough for at least 3 hours or overnight.
Step 3
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Lightly grease a baking sheet.
Step 4
Remove dough from the refrigerator and form into walnut sized balls. Roll balls in white sugar. Place balls about 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heet.
Step 5
Bake at 375 degrees F (190 degrees C) for 8 to 10 minutes for chewy cookies and 10 to 12 minutes for crisper cookies. Store cookies in an airtight container.

Ingredients

  • 2 eggs
  • 2 cups white sugar
  • 4 teaspoons baking soda
  • 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 1 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up molasses
  • 1 ½ cups shortening
